web-dev-qa-db-ja.com

Gitフローコマンドエラー: 'flow'はgitコマンドではありません

私はGitに非常に慣れていないため、コマンドラインバージョンについて学び始めています。 gitフローが正しくインストールされていないと思います。私はこれをPCから実行しています。

次のコマンドを実行すると:

git flow feature start JamesTest

次のエラーが発生します。

git: 'flow'はgitコマンドではありません。 「git --help」を参照してください
これらのいずれかを意味しましたか?

Git flowコマンドがすべてのパスから認識されていないようですか?どうすれば修正できますか?

15
NetSystemAdmin

Gitはインストールされていますが、Gitflowはインストールされていません。 GitflowはGit拡張機能であり、個別にインストールする必要があります。

GitHubで説明 としてインストールしてください。問題はありません;)

11
Luboš Turek

WindowsにGit Flowをインストールする場合は、次のようにします( この手順 に基づいて)

  1. Gitフローリポジトリのクローンを作成する

    git clone --recursive git://github.com/nvie/gitflow.git
    
  2. getopt アーカイブをダウンロードし、getopt.exeファイルをGit実行可能ファイルがインストールされている場所(C:\ Programs\Git\binなど)に抽出します。

  3. 次のコマンドを実行します。引数はGitパスのインストールです(ここでも、C:\ Programs\Gitのようなものです)。ここでbinディレクトリを指定する必要はありません。

    contrib\msysgit-install.cmd "C:\Programs\Git"
    

以上です。コマンドgit flowを使用して、すべてが機能していることを確認します

2
Luís Cruz